Handover — ChipHerald reader service. Queue drains fine now; fixed the double-read bug at mat crossings by widening the debounce window. Firmware sync job still flaky on cold boot — retry logic is in the branch awaiting your review. Don't touch the antenna gain table, race ops tuned it manually last weekend. Everything you need to reproduce my setup is in the following values.

service settings:
[casax]
port = 6379
team = rusir
host = casax.zemvarhq.corp
region = outer-4
access_code = ac_9808ce
timeout_ms = 1500

Step 4 — Signing the Togglewright rollout bundle

For security review: each feature-flag rollout bundle must be signed prior to distribution so edge nodes can verify flag payloads before applying them. Confirm the bundle hash matches the review record, then perform the signing step using the deploy key provided below.

rollout seal: bky4_DFM9

The PerkLedger API tracks every loyalty-points event as an append-only ledger entry, so don't ever try to mutate a row — post a compensating entry instead, future you will thank present you. Balances are computed lazily and cached for five minutes by the Glimmerhawk service, which explains the occasional stale read folks complain about. All write endpoints require elevated scope, and reads need at least the viewer role. For local testing against the sandbox ledger, authenticate using the token that follows.

login token, kagaf-bawig: eyJhbGciOiJIUzI1NiIsInR5cCI6IkpXVCJ9.eyJzdWIiOiI1b8bmcIn0.xjc0uBP3

Subject: Transition to Annual Billing — Department Heads

Team,

Following the pricing review, we intend to move Solvane subscribers from monthly to annual billing starting next cycle. Finance projects smoother cash flow and reduced churn, but support volumes will spike during migration, so please plan staffing accordingly. Legacy monthly plans remain available for existing enterprise accounts through year end. Detailed timelines will follow from the programme office. The confidential rationale is noted below.

board note of bawep-tajef: Queniusek Systems plans to raise the Quenvan list price by 53.1 percent in March. The pricing group signed off on a budget of $176.4 million for Project Drueth. The renewal with Casionix Partners closes at $142.5 million a year, 8.3 percent below the last contract. Project Fraax slips by six weeks because of the tooling delay.